Global Methacrylate Monomers Market size was valued at USD 20.22 Billion in 2024 and is poised to grow from USD 21.29 Billion in 2025 to USD 32.18 Billion by 2033, growing at a CAGR of 5.3% during the forecast period (2026-2033).
The market for methacrylate monomers, highly reactive industrial building blocks for polymers, is poised for growth driven by ongoing industrialization and urbanization. Innovations in polymer technology are expected to boost sales significantly, while a global shift towards sustainability positions methacrylate monomers as a safer alternative to harmful volatile organic compounds. However, fluctuating raw material prices may hinder the market's complete growth potential. The automotive industry's rapid expansion and increasing demand for lightweight materials further present significant opportunities for methacrylate monomer producers. As environmental considerations continue to gain importance, companies that focus on these more sustainable options are likely to benefit and capture a larger share of the market.

Global Methacrylate Monomers Market Segments Analysis
Global Methacrylate Monomers Market is segmented by Derivatives, Application, End-Use Industry and region. Based on Derivatives, the market is segmented into Methyl Methacrylate, Butyl Methacrylate, Ethyl Methacrylate, 2-Hydroxyethyl Methacrylate, Allyl Methacrylate, Glycidyl Methacrylate, Cyclohexyl Methacrylate, Stearyl Methacrylate and Lauryl Methacrylate. Based on Application, the market is segmented into Acrylic Sheets, Molding, Paints & Coatings, Additives and Others. Based on End-Use Industry, the market is segmented into Automotive, Architecture & Construction, Electronics, Advertisement & Communication and Others. Based on region, the market is segmented into North America, Europe, Asia Pacific, Latin America and Middle East & Africa.
